Currently operating out of two spaces, our mobile gallery and the gallery at the City of Yellowknife’s Visitor Centre; the galleries have worked to:
Broaden the
audiences for art
Promote the diversity of art and craft in the NWT
Allow opportunities for curatorial work and thematic shows.
Boost the professional resumes of artists seeking to enter the national field.


About YKARCC
Founded in 2011, the Yellowknife Artist Run Community Centre is a non-profit organization facilitating the production and presentation of Yellowknife and NWT artwork. It brings artists and organization of all art forms together and encourages collaboration. Our mission is to inspire and nurture expression through the presentation, production and interpretation of multidisciplinary art forms for the benefit of the community. Our vision is a community where individuals are empowered to create positive change through art.
YKARCC currently programs exhibitions in the Yellowknife Visitor Centre gallery (Centre Square Mall – 5014 50th St) open daily 10 am – 6 pm and pop-up programming in our mobile art gallery trailer.
We acknowledge and respect that we are in the Chief Drygeese territory. From time immemorial, it has been the traditional land of the Yellowknives Dene First Nation.
